标签: SQLite

Android之SQLite数据库的使用

SQLite是比较小而功能比较全的关系型数据库,下面介绍一下SQLite数据库的使用方法,及增删改查操作。

创建一个Android项目;

首先我们需要创建一个DatabaseHelper这个助手类,源码:

package cn.android.sword.sqlite.db;

import android.content.Context;
import android.database.sqlite.SQLiteDatabase;
import android.da[……]

阅读全文»

在VC中使用SQLite的例子

我打算在PonySE上把SQLite做为第一个保存”转换数据”的数据库, 所以今天小试了一把SQLite, 觉得它使用起来很简洁.
环境: VS2005 VC8.0

一. 准备工作:
(1)在SQLite的官方网站下载Windows平台下的3.5.0 版本的SQLite, 下载地址:
http://www.sqlite.org/sqlitedll-3_5_0.zip
压缩文件中包含了sqlite3.dll和sqlite3.def文件. 用LIB命令生成用于连接(LINK)使用的lib文件:[……]

阅读全文»

C/C++中调用SQLITE3的基本步骤

Sqlite 是一个面向嵌入式系统的数据库,编译完成只有200K,同时支持2T的数据记录。对于嵌入式设备是一个很好的数据库引擎。本文通过一个小例子说明如何在C 与C++调用Sqlite API完成数据库的创建、插入数据与查询数据。本文的开发环境为(Redhat9.0 + Qtopia2.1.2 + Sqlite3)

安装Sqlite3:

从www.sqlite.org上下载Sqlite3.2.2运源代码,依照Readme中的步骤:

tar xzf sqlite3.2.2.tar.gz[……]

阅读全文»

在VC6.0中使用C++访问sqlite数据库

在sqlite.org上下载得到Windows版本的sqlite,它是以sqlitedll.zip文件提供的,其中有sqlite3.def和 sqlite3.dll文件,当然可以直接通过LoadLibrary等WIN32API来操作dll,查找其中包含的函数,并使用这些函数,但是一般都不这么做,原因很简单:这样太麻烦,所以一般先使用LIB命令生成用于链接的lib,然后把sqlite头文件sqlite3.h包含进程序中, 这样直接调用 sqlite的API就方便多了.当然sqlite3.h文件得从sql[……]

阅读全文»

SQLite在VC下的使用

下载源代码 一、SQLite简介 SQLite 是用C语言编写的开源数据库,主要用于嵌入式,你也可以把它集成在自己的桌面程序中,也有人将其替代Access,用作后台数据库。 SQLite 支持多数SQL92标准,例如:索引、限制、触发和查看支持。 支持 NULL、INTEGER、REAL、TEXT 和 BLOB 数据类型,支持事务。 二、下载SQLite SQLite可以到官方站点下载 http://www.sqlite.org/download.html 包括[……]

阅读全文»

SQLite C/C++接口介绍

这篇文章是使用SQLite C/C++接口的一个概要介绍和入门指南。 由于早期的SQLite只支持5个C/C++接口,因而非常容易学习和使用,但是随着SQLite功能的增强,新的C/C++接口不断的增加进来,到现在有超过150个不同的API接口。这往往使初学者望而却步。幸运的是,大多数SQLite中的C/C++接口是专用的,因而很少被使用到。尽管有这么多的调用接口,核心的API仍然相对简单和便于调用。本片文章的目的就是为了能够更易于理解SQLite的运作提供基础的知识。 另一篇独立的文档《The[……]

阅读全文»

摆脱MySQL,让WordPress投奔SQLite

Wordpress默认就是与MySQL搭配的,这次要为wordpress换一个数据库搭档,但这并不是说MySQL如何的不优秀,但在10万以下的低并发访问,SQLite这样的单文件轻量级数据库系统性能优异,体积小、读取速度快、容量大,免费、开源,其实更适合像blog、或中小型站点的这种场景的数据库应用。 如果你需要独立为数据库服务支付购买,或者并不满意主机系统繁杂的mySQL数据服务,倒真的是应该尝试一下SQLite这样的轻量级数据库。 SQLite官网:http://www[……]

阅读全文»

鄂ICP备13000209号-1

鄂公网安备 42050602000277号